A bedroom is a personal space, a place of rest and rejuvenation. The bed, as the centerpiece of this space, deserves a headboard that is both beautiful and expressive of personal style. While store-bought options are plentiful, a do-it-yourself headboard offers a unique opportunity to infuse creativity and personality into your room.
Here are some inspiring DIY headboard ideas to give your bedroom a significant glow-up.
1. The Elegance of Upholstery
Upholstered headboards are a timeless trend, and for good reason. They add a touch of softness, luxury, and comfort to any bedroom. For a DIY approach, a simple plywood base, foam padding, and a chic fabric are all that are needed. Consider trendy materials like bouclé or velvet for a touch of opulence. For a more classic look, a simple tufted design can be created with buttons and a bit of patience.
2. The Rustic Charm of Wood
Wood is a versatile material that can be adapted to a variety of design styles. For a rustic, farmhouse-chic vibe, consider using reclaimed wood or pallets. The natural imperfections and variations in the wood grain will add character and warmth to the space. A simple arrangement of wooden planks, either horizontally or vertically, can create a stunning and cost-effective headboard. A coat of varnish or a distressed paint finish can further enhance the rustic appeal.
3. The Art of the Painted Headboard
For those who are short on space or prefer a minimalist aesthetic, a painted headboard is a brilliant and creative solution. This can be as simple as painting a rectangular shape on the wall behind the bed, or as intricate as a detailed mural or geometric pattern. Two-tone color palettes are particularly on-trend, creating a bold and graphic statement. This is a low-cost, high-impact option that can be easily updated with a fresh coat of paint.
4. The Statement-Making Oversized Headboard
Oversized and extended headboards are a major trend for 2025, creating a dramatic and luxurious focal point in the bedroom. A DIY oversized headboard can be crafted from a large piece of plywood and upholstered in a bold fabric or wallpaper. This can also be a functional choice by incorporating built-in shelving or sconces for a smart and multifunctional design.
5. The Natural Beauty of Rattan and Cane
Embracing natural and organic materials is another key trend for the coming year. Rattan and cane headboards bring a touch of bohemian elegance and texture to the bedroom. While creating a woven headboard from scratch may be a more advanced project, pre-made rattan panels or screens can be easily adapted into a beautiful and stylish headboard.
